Unreleased structure
The entry 3nyh is ON HOLD
Authors: Pandey, N., Singh, A.K., Sinha, M., Kaur, P., Sharma, S., Singh, T.P.
Description: Crystal structure of lactoperoxidase complexed simultaneously with thiocyanate ion, iodide ion, bromide ion, chloride ion through the substrate diffusion channel reveals a preferential queue of the inorganic substrates towards the distal heme cavity
